Indiana Receiving Grant to Fight Bat Disease

INDIANAPOLIS (AP): Indiana will receive $36,500 from the federal government in hopes of curbing the spread of white-nose syndrome. Indiana is one of 30 states receiving a total of nearly $1.3 million in grants to combat the disease. Officials say white-nose syndrome has spread from one state in 2007 to 25 states and five Canadian provinces this year.
